Plumbing diagnostics and repairs, toilet and faucet replacement, shutoff and valve upgrades, repiping for fixture locations, drain-related service tied to small projects, and coordination for condo and multifamily work.

As part of a new kitchen in a 10 unit condo in Brookline we had to have a building drain down to replace the hot and cold water shutoffs which we old and not closing completely. We scheduled the work with Alewife and the property manager. Alewife arrived bed as scheduled and completed the drain down and valve replacement. They also made suggestions about where the valves should be located for easy access. Overall fantastic work!
